Marcus Rashford has made 'Tottenham decision' amid £70m Antonio Conte interest in Man Utd star

Marcus Rashford is set for talks with new Manchester United manager Erik ten Hag ahead of the summer transfer window, according to reports. It comes amid reported interest from Tottenham, with the market officially opening on Friday.

Spurs are set for a huge few months when it comes to transforming the squad, with Antonio Conte looking to continue the momentum from finishing fourth and returning to the Champions League. Two deals have already been confirmed, with Ivan Perisic and Fraser Forster joining the club as free agents.

There’s plenty more business to be done though, as hinted at by the head coach towards the end of the season: “We need to improve a lot. Next season the league will be very difficult for all the teams.

“With five subs you can change a game. If the bench is strong like a top team, like City, Chelsea, United and Liverpool, you need to improve a lot your squad in quality aspect and numerical aspect. You have to face in England three national competitions and one in the Champions League.”

In a bid to add depth and quality to his squad, Conte has been linked with a number of options. However, the latest was Marcus Rashford, with his agent confirming the Lilywhites opened talks over a move, but a price tag of £70million set makes the move tough.

The 24-year-old only has one-year remaining on his contract at Old Trafford, but struggled in the past season with getting regular first-team minutes. This has opened up speculation surrounding his future at the club.

However, Fabrizio Romano claims in his Caught Offside article that the striker is set for talks with new boss ten Hag about his role in the team and his contract situation. He adds that the forward has not decided to leave the club this summer.

This is only added by journalist James Robson claiming that the new manager has “high hopes” for Rashford in the future. It remains to be seen exactly what his future holds, but it appears that it may not be at Tottenham.
